Draw two lines from the vanishing point to the edge of the page. The lines should be under the vanishing line. When you are just beginning to learn to draw train tracks, your lines should be symmetrical on the page coming from the vanishing point and making an upside-down V on the page. When you get the hang of it, you can begin drawing the off to one side.

Tips & Warnings
Always use the vanishing point on the page as a reference for other details.
Draw items at the bottom of the page with more detail and larger to give your image proper perspective.
